It was Battle of the Soft-Tossing Lefties today, Fabio Castro for Las Vegas and Heath Phillips for Omaha. Neither of them threw harder than 87 MPH, but both of them pitched fairly well, though they had good defensive support and some luck behind them. Final score was Las Vegas 2, Omaha 0, in 11 innings. Ironically, the best stuff of the night belonged to Carlos Rosa, who was also the only pitcher to give up a run. He touched 96 once and was hitting 92 consistently with movement. Breaking ball was erratic.


Jordan Parraz has some pop to the opposite field but doesn't pull the ball much, at least in the two games I saw.
